Bonnie J Amos, 85 of Shelbyville, Indiana died on Wednesday, July 29, 2015, at Forest Creek Village in Indianapolis, Indiana.
Born December 30, 1929 in Huntington County, Indiana, she was the daughter of Charles Hedrick and Pauline (Stephens) Hedrick.
She married Samuel P. Amos and he preceded her in death on July 15, 2011.
Surviving are sons, Anthony (Stephanie) Amos of Greenwood, IN and Donald (Julie) Amos of Arkansas, daughter, Vicki (Brian) Mann of Michigan, brother, Jay Dee Hedrick of Huntington, IN.
She was also preceded in death by her parents and three siblings.
Mrs. Amos worked in a factory as a dress maker.
